How to subscribe to RSS feeds using TheOldReader.com and Google Chrome

Why I Switched to TheOldReader.com

When Google announced that they would be phasing out Google Reader, I was more than a little disappointed. I loved the Google Reader experience - it's how I keep abreast of the latest animation techniques and also how I stay up-to-date with job postings without having to manually search for updates. After about a month of denial where I continued to use Google Reader, I am now making the transition to my new RSS Reader TheOldReader.com. I selected TheOldReader.com because they offer the closest experience to what I was used to in Google Reader: a clean but bare-bones reader that minimizes distraction.

Subscribing to Feeds in Google Chrome


  1. Install the GoogleChrome RSS Subscription Extension (By Google)
  2. Add TheOldReader.com as your default RSS Reader
    1. Go into your extension settings (file pull down (looks like three horizontal bars) -> Tools -> Extensions
    2. Open the RSS Subscription Extension Options (Scroll to RSS Subscription Extension and click on the small blue options link)
    3. Click on the "Add..." button to add a new feed reader
    4. In the "Description" field enter: The Old Reader
    5. In the url field enter: http://theoldreader.com/feeds/subscribe?url=%s
    6. Choose save
    7. Select The Old Reader, and choose "Make Default"
    8. Turn on "Always use my default reader when subscribing to feeds."
  3. Browse to a page with an RSS
  4. Click on the orange RSS icon that shows up in your URL bar to subscribe

WTF: No, seriously, What The Font?!

If you want to know what font a client is using in their project, consider: What The Font.

Just upload an image and using their crazy robots and powers of typographic delight, they will tell you what font is in that image. The world amazes me. Special thanks to sender-inner R. Blaik.
